Layer-2 Speed and EVM Mainnet: Fast, Affordable, Compatible

Injective runs on a Layer-2 architecture, which means sub-second block times and almost zero fees. The November 2025 EVM mainnet allows Ethereum dApps to run directly on Injective. Developers can deploy their existing Ethereum projects without rewriting code while tapping into liquidity from Ethereum, Solana, and Cosmos.

For traders, this means:

Fast execution of orders

Minimal fees

Easy access to multiple chains

Decentralized Derivatives: Professional Tools for Everyone

Injective makes derivatives accessible to all. Futures, perpetual swaps, and margin trading are fully decentralized. On-chain order books ensure real-time liquidity, fairness, and transparency.

Retail traders can use professional strategies

Institutions get scalable, transparent access

Markets operate without hidden liquidity

INJ Tokenomics: Rewards and Scarcity

INJ powers governance, staking, and fee settlement. A large part of dApp fees—60%—is burned monthly, creating scarcity.

Encourages long-term holding

Strengthens network incentives

Supports token value
